网站地图(Sitemap)是网站内容结构的一个重要组成部分,它帮助搜索引擎更好地了解和索引网站的页面。在互联网的海洋中,一个好的网站地图就像是一盏明灯,引导搜索引擎的蜘蛛(crawlers)全面而高效地爬行和收录网站内容。这里,我们将详细分析网站地图对搜索引擎收录的作用,并提供一些关于如何创建和提交网站地图的免费教程。
一、网站地图的定义和类型
网站地图通常有两种类型:
<><>
HTML地图:
这是为
用户设计的,用于帮助他们导航到网站的不同部分。它通常出现在网站首页的底部区域,以直观的方式展示网站结构。<>
XML地图:
这是专门为搜索引擎设计的,以XML格式编写,包含网站所有页面的URL,以及其他重要的元数据,如更新频率和优先级。
二、网站地图的作用
<>
提高收录效率:
搜索引擎蜘蛛通过网站地图可以快速发现和爬行网站的所有页面,这有助于提高网页的收录速度和覆盖率。<>
减少爬行陷阱:
网站地图可以帮助搜索引擎避免那些可能导致蜘蛛陷入无限循环的动态网站结构,如具有大量参数和分页的内容系统。<>
提供内容更新信息:
通过网站地图,可以告诉搜索引擎各个页面的更新频率和优先级,从而让搜索引擎更有针对性地抓取最新内容。<>
改善SEO表现:
一个完整的网站地图有助于搜索引擎更好地理解网站内容的价值,从而可能提高在搜索结果中的排名。<>
方便搜索引擎索引:
对于大型网站来说,网站地图可以帮助搜索引擎更全面地索引内容,避免遗漏重要的页面。
三、创建网站地图的免费教程
有许多在线工具和服务可以帮助我们创建网站地图,以下是一些免费资源和步骤:
<>
使用在线生成器:
有许多在线工具,如Google Search Console、XML-Sitemaps.com、Screaming Frog SEO Spider等,可以自动生成XML网站地图。这些工具通常只需要输入网站的URL,便能生成一个完整的网站地图。<>
使用CMS插件:
如果你的网站是通过内容管理系统(CMS)如WordPress、Joomla或Drupal构建的,通常这些CMS都提供了插件或内置功能来自动生成网站地图。<>
手动创建:
对于小型网站或者需要特殊格式的网站地图,可以手动创建。需要了解XML格式的基本规则,并列出所有页面的URL,可能还需要包括其他元数据。<>
定期更新:
网站地图应定期更新,以反映网站内容的变化。例如,每当添加新页面或删除旧页面时,应该更新网站地图。
四、提交网站地图给搜索引擎的免费教程
创建网站地图后,下一步是将其提交给搜索引擎,以下是一些免费方法:
<>
使用搜索引擎的提交工具:
Google Search Console、Bing Webmaster Tools等工具都提供了提交网站地图的功能。登录相应的工具后,按照指示上传或输入网站地图的URL即可。<>
使用Robots.txt文件:
在网站的根目录下创建一个名为robots.txt的文件,在这个文件中指定网站地图的位置。搜索引擎蜘蛛扫描网站时会自动查找这个文件。<>
使用网站地图提交协议:
确保网站地图符合XML Sitemaps协议的标准,这样搜索引擎可以更容易地识别和处理。<>
检查索引状态:
提交网站地图后,可以使用搜索引擎提供的工具检查网页的索引状态,确保网站地图被正确处理。
五、总结
网站地图对于提高网站在搜索引擎中的可见性和排名至关重要。通过创建和提交网站地图,我们可以确保搜索引擎更有效地发现和索引网站内容。以上提到的免费教程和资源可以帮助网站管理员轻松地创建和提交网站地图,从而优化网站的搜索引擎优化(SEO)表现。